As part of our ongoing commitment to community and school engagement, we have been working closely with staff and pupils at St Bridget’s Primary School in Kilbirnie.

Connect Modular is currently delivering 14 affordable homes for North Ayrshire Council across four separate sites in the Garnock Valley and St Bridget’s primary school is situated adjacent to the first site on Newhouse Drive, Kilbirnie where three amenity bungalows will be constructed.

Earlier this month the Connect Modular Marketing team visited St Bridget’s Primary to deliver a presentation for pupils at their assembly covering topics including modular construction, health and safety and careers in construction. The team also invited pupils to enter its writing competition, asking them to write an acrostic poem to describe modular construction or to write about what home means to them.

We were blown away with the volume of submissions and the high quality of work we received and it was a very difficult job to whittle this down to the three winners; Rhys, Amelia and Hayley. We loved their work so much, we invited them along to read out their winning poetry at the ground-breaking event for 14-home development for North Ayrshire Council and they did an incredible job.

To thank the school children for their hard work and amazing effort, each pupil was rewarded with a £15 gift card for Amazon.
